What is the RBC Client Account Information Form?
The RBC Client Account Information Form serves as a crucial tool for gathering necessary details about clients opening or updating investment accounts. This form is designed to facilitate the collection of comprehensive client information, enhancing the efficiency of account management.
Key components of the form include sections dedicated to account type, ownership details, personal identification, and the financial profiles of clients. By utilizing this form, RBC ensures that all relevant client data is captured systematically, aiding in effective investment strategies.

Who Needs the RBC Client Account Information Form?
The RBC Client Account Information Form must be completed by several key roles in the context of account management. These roles include the Primary Account Owner or Trustee, Joint Tenant or Co-Trustee, Financial Advisor, and Firm Principal.
Situations necessitating the completion of this form range from opening a new investment account to updating existing client information.

Who needs to fill out the RBC Client Account Information Form?
This form is necessary for individuals opening or updating an investment account with RBC Capital Markets. It is required for primary account owners, trustees, joint tenants, and financial advisors assisting clients.
Are there any deadlines associated with this form?
Generally, there are no specific deadlines for filling out the RBC Client Account Information Form. However, timely submission is essential to ensure that your investment account is operational when you need it.
What information is required to complete the form?
You will need to provide personal identification, financial information such as income and investment goals, and details about account ownership. Make sure to have all relevant documents on hand for accuracy.
Can I submit this form electronically?
Yes, you can complete and submit the RBC Client Account Information Form electronically through pdfFiller. Ensure you follow the platform's specific submission instructions for electronic forms.
What are common mistakes to avoid while filling out the form?
Common mistakes include incorrect personal information, incomplete financial details, and missing signatures. Always double-check all entries and ensure each section is filled out as required.
How long does it take to process the submitted form?
The processing time for the RBC Client Account Information Form can vary based on the specific requirements of RBC Capital Markets. Generally, expect processing times of several days after submission.
Is notarization required for this form?
No, notarization is not required for the RBC Client Account Information Form, making it more straightforward to complete and submit.
